目的为提高食用油中黄曲霉毒素ELISA检测的精密度与准确度,对检测相关条件进行优化探讨。方法通过调整样品前处理以及免疫反应过程中一些实验参数,对比不同实验条件下实际样品测定值的RSD与回收率,取一定量样品提取液加入样品稀释液后按ELISA测定程序进行测定。结果在优化条件下样品加标回收率在75.5%~115.6%之间,同一个样品提取液做多孔平行其RSD小于8.5%。以超高效液相色谱串联质谱(UPLC-MS-MS)进行确认检测结果满意。结论优化后的检测条件有效地改善了检测过程中不确定性,样品检测结果的平行性和重复性较好,本实验对食用油中黄曲霉毒素B1的有关优化研究参数可以作为实际检测分析的参考,适用于实验室常规检测。
Objective To improve the precision and accuracy of aflatoxin ELISA in food oil, and to optimize the detection conditions. Methods By adjusting the sample pretreatment and some experimental parameters in the course of immune reaction, the RSD and recovery of the actual samples under different experimental conditions were compared. A certain amount of sample extract was added to the sample diluent and then measured by ELISA. Results The spiked recoveries of spiked samples ranged from 75.5% to 115.6% under the optimized conditions. The RSD of the same sample was less than 8.5%. Confirmation by ultra performance liquid chromatography tandem mass spectrometry (UPLC-MS-MS) showed satisfactory results. Conclusion The optimized detection conditions can effectively improve the uncertainty of the detection process. The parallelism and repeatability of the detection results are good. The parameters of optimization of aflatoxin B1 in edible oils can be used as the actual detection and analysis Reference, suitable for routine laboratory testing.
